THUNDER BAY – LIVESTREAM – The North Superior Workforce Planning Board will celebrate their 20th Anniversary on Wednesday, October 11th, 2017.

As a part of the anniversary celebration on Wednesday, October 11th there will be a Panel Discussion on the Ring of Fire. This talk will be carried live on NetNewsLedger from 5-8PM.

Ring of Fire Panel Discussion Members are:

Chief Bruce Achneepineskum, Marten Falls First Nation;

Glenn Nolan, VP Aboriginal Affairs, Noront Resources;

Moe Lavigne, Vice President Exploration & Development, KWG Resources Inc.;

JP Gladu, President and CEO, Canadian Council for Aboriginal Business;

There will also be a representative from the Ministry of Northern Development and Mines.
